Record and Growth:
On-line poker appeared when you look at the late 1990s due to advancements in technology therefore the internet. Initial internet poker area,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. However, it was in early 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Benefits of Internet Poker:
On-line poker provides a number of advantages over conventional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it gives a wider variety of game options, including numerous poker variations and stakes, catering to the choices and spending plans of most forms of people. In addition, on-line poker areas tend to be open 24/7, eliminating the limitations of actual casino operating hours. Additionally, on the web platforms often provide attractive incentives, loyalty programs, as well as the capability to play multiple tables at the same time, enhancing the overall video gaming knowledge.

Financial and Social Impact:
The development of online poker has received an important economic impact globally. Online poker systems generate considerable income through rake charges, tournament entry fees, and advertising. This revenue has generated task creation and opportunities into the video gaming industry. Moreover, online poker has actually contributed to a rise in taxation income for governing bodies in which its regulated, encouraging community services.
From a personal viewpoint, online poker has actually fostered an international poker community, bridging geographic barriers. People from diverse experiences and places can interact and compete, cultivating a feeling of camaraderie. Online poker has also played a vital role in promoting the game's popularity and attracting brand-new people, ultimately causing the development of poker business as a whole.
